The Mazda Flair is a kei-class hatchback, essentially a rebadged Suzuki Alto/MR Wagon built under a Suzuki-Mazda partnership, sold in Japan and occasionally imported to Pakistan as a used unit. It comes in Standard, XG, XS, and Hybrid trims, with the Hybrid variant using a mild-hybrid system that improves fuel economy noticeably in city stop-go traffic. The 660cc engine is relaxed rather than peppy — fine for urban commuting but not for highway overtaking. The CVT transmission in most variants is smooth in traffic but can feel sluggish under hard acceleration.
Because this is a Japanese import rather than a locally assembled car, parts availability in Pakistan is limited compared to Suzuki Alto or Honda City. Mechanics in smaller cities may not be familiar with it, though the shared Suzuki platform means some components cross over. Resale value is moderate — buyers tend to prefer locally assembled alternatives, so liquidity can be an issue if you need to sell quickly. The Hybrid variant commands a small premium but also narrows the buyer pool further.
The Flair suits a buyer who wants a compact, fuel-efficient city car and is comfortable sourcing parts through importers. The honest limitation is after-sales support outside major cities. Best suited for Karachi, Lahore, or Islamabad where Japanese import specialists operate.
